Extracts (petroleum), heavy naphthenic distillate solvent, hydrodesulfurized
Extracts (petroleum), heavy naphthenic distillate solvent, hydrodesulfurized is a substance with a harmonised classification under EU CLP.

Other names for Extracts (petroleum), heavy…
- Distillate aromatic extract (treated)
- [A complex combination of hydrocarbons obtained from a petroleum stock by treating with hydrogen to convert organic sulfur to hydrogen sulfide which is removed. It consists predominantly of hydrocarbons having carbon numbers predominantly in the range of C15 through C50 and produces a finished oil with a viscosity of greater than 19cSt at 40 °C.]
02 · GHS classification
Hazards and label elements
Harmonised classification under CLP Annex VI. This is the legally binding classification in the EU; other jurisdictions may differ.
| Code | Hazard statement |
|---|---|
| H350 | May cause cancer <state route of exposure if it is conclusively proven that no other routes of exposure cause the hazard>. |
